Eric Chelle Seeks Salary Increase as Nigeria Coach

Eric Chelle, the head coach of Nigeria's senior national football team, has defended his request for a significant salary increase from $50,000 to $130,000 per month amid public criticism. During an appearance on the "Histoir de Foot" podcast, Chelle explained that the proposed amount is not solely for him but also to cover the salaries of his technical support staff.

He emphasized that coaching an African national team comes with the responsibility of ensuring that backroom personnel are adequately compensated. Chelle noted the immense pressure associated with leading a national team in a country with a population exceeding 250 million people, making it necessary to build a reliable team and maintain a professional support system.

He insisted that the national team coach requires a similar structure to perform effectively. Chelle described the ongoing contract discussions as part of a normal negotiation process, stating that his representatives aim to secure the best possible terms with the Nigeria Football Federation.
